Agrion Halophile vs Agrion Porte-Coupe
Enallagma clausum compared with Enallagma cyathigerum
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Agrion Halophile | Agrion Porte-Coupe |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(arthropodes) | Arthropoda (arthropodes) |
| Class same | Insecta (insecte) | Insecta (insecte) |
| Order same | Odonata (Odonata) | Odonata (Odonata) |
| Family same | Coenagrionidae | Coenagrionidae |
| Genus same | Enallagma | Enallagma |
| Species | Enallagma clausum | Enallagma cyathigerum |
Evolutionary Relationship
Agrion Halophile and Agrion Porte-Coupe share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Enallagma.

Agrion Halophile
The Alkali Bluet (Enallagma clausum) is a species in the genus Enallagma.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
Agrion Porte-Coupe
Common Blue Damselfly (Enallagma cyathigerum) is classified as Least Concern (LC) on the IUCN Red List. Widespread and abundant across its range, with stable populations and no immediate conservation concerns.
